Inaugurating Study Program Head, Rector Reminds That Curriculum Should Not Be Rigid
Rector of the Universitas Sumatera Utara Dr. Muryanto Amin, S.Sos., M.Si., inaugurated the Heads and Secretaries of Departments, Heads and Secretaries of Study Programs and Heads of new Laboratories within USU. The inauguration was held at the USU Central Administration Bureau Building on Friday (1/10/2021).
The Rector said that the study program is the spearhead of the implementation of learning and is a determinant of the quality of universities and study programs which is very important for the success of all matters relating to the assessment of independent institutions. The study program is expected to be able to quickly change the learning curriculum and learning methods in accordance with existing developments, so as to create a bridge between industry and universities.
“Hopefully the mandate and oath of office can be the most basic guidelines for carrying out our duties. The change is a necessity, we continue to change according to the rapidly developing conditions outside, "said the Rector in his speech.
The Rector emphasized the most important task for the Chair and Secretary of the Study Program, classrooms must be designed to be able to create students who understand problems, have ideas and communicate them to others. In World Class University, the measurement for journal publication is the process of inviting students to express their ideas in an article.
"The curriculum should not be rigid, learning methods must also respond to developments that occur outside the curriculum to be our guide so that students can adapt to the needs of the industrial world, our contribution to study programs is to make graduates have meaning, can be responded to and can be absorbed by the industrial world," continued the Rector .
As for the Head and Secretary of the Department, the Rector advised that his function is to manage resources including lecturers and infrastructure. The Rector reminded postgraduate managers that it is important to strengthen and spread the dissemination and development of knowledge through journals.
“Many lecturers have been left behind to be able to handle functional ranks and positions. Later, there will be a special design to be able to process ranks, positions and academic degrees to be able to achieve more than 50 percent of doctorates, and more than 50 percent of professors," the Rector said.
The Rector also hopes for collaboration between the head of the study program, the head of the department and the dean. With collaboration and hard work, the Rector believes that USU can achieve campus internationalization in the next two to three years.
"My message about the infrastructure in the classroom has been conveyed to the dean and vice dean to pay attention to all processes for the needs of the chairperson and secretary of the study program for the learning process," he said. (©ULC)
